IHG to launch two Holiday Inn Express hotels in Grimsby and Middlesbrough

InterContinental Hotels Group (IHG) has announced the signing of two new hotels under its budget brand Holiday Inn Express in Grimsby and Middlesbrough.

The 80-bedroom, new-build Holiday Inn Express Grimsby will operate under a franchise agreement with Brayford Hotels. Located in the town centre near the main railway station, it is due to open at the end of 2015.


Located on the main square of Middlesbrough town centre, the hotel will be close to the Middlesbrough Institute of Modern Art and Cleveland Centre shopping mall.

IHG has also announced a 198-bedroom Holiday Express in Dublin city centre, to be operated on a franchise basis with existing IHG owner Findlater House.

Philip Lassman, director of development UK and Ireland, IHG said: "Holiday Inn Express is one of the fastest growing brands in the industry and the brand is certainly doing really well in Europe. The brand offers friendly efficient service, comfortable rooms and a free breakfast - everything a guest needs and nothing they don't.

Richard Farrar, director of Leaf Hospitality, the company managing Holiday Inn Express Grimsby on behalf of Brayford Hotels, commented: "Brayford Hotels is delighted to be adding Holiday Inn Express Grimsby to their portfolio. We were all determined to build a quality branded hotel the moment the site was acquired and we'll do just that over the coming twelve months."

Mark Ashall, director of Ashall Projects, the property development company undertaking the Middlesbrough project, said: "We are delighted to have secured the opportunity to refurbish this building and contribute to the regeneration of the centre of Middlesbrough by welcoming Holiday Inn Express to the town."

Launched in 1991, Holiday Inn Express is one of the world 's largest and fastest growing hotel brands in the hotel industry, opening properties at an average rate of two per week. Currently there are over 2,260 Holiday Inn Express hotels globally, accounting for nearly half of the 4,704-strong IHG portfolio.

There are 219 Holiday Inn Express hotels in Europe and a further 38 in the pipeline.
